Alliant Insurance Services is a national insurance brokerage and risk-management firm that provides property & casualty insurance, employee benefits consulting, reinsurance, claims assistance, disaster preparedness and recovery, captive insurance, and a range of industry-specific risk solutions (e. g. , agribusiness, aviation, construction, cyber, energy, healthcare, real estate & hospitality, transportation). The firm emphasizes benefits consulting and human capital services in addition to traditional brokerage, and positions itself as a full-service advisor for commercial clients. Alliant is one of the largest brokers in the U. S. , noting roughly $5. 7B in revenue and $55B+ in premiums, and is ranked among the top brokers nationally and globally.

📋 Description

• Responsible for providing technical employee benefits related compliance guidance to external employee benefits clients and internal employee benefits staff. • Provides consistent strategic support to Alliant Employee Benefits National Operations. • Leads team members. • Responsible for strategic decision making about compliance content development and deployment. • Uses independent judgment to respond to difficult client and account team situations • Develop subject matter expertise and responsibility for supporting the team, and acts as a subject matter expert during staff trainings. • Leads and may supervise team members, delegates and monitors work, handles escalated inquiries, conducts staff training and fields questions. • Timely develops content addressing new compliance legislation on behalf of the national Compliance team for distribution internally and to clients in a straightforward, practical way; includes educational webinars, seminars, alerts, white papers, checklists, frequently asked questions (FAQs) etc.; includes review and ability to understand and summarize regulatory source material. • Partners with other members of the Compliance team to ensure Compliance portal content is current Partners with brokers, managing directors, and service teams on key accounts; includes attending meetings and participating in conference calls per established national Compliance engagement protocol. • Engages with local operational lead to assess local client compliance needs and account team training needs. • Contributes significantly in developing Compliance content for the national Compliance team, for client distribution and to educate staff on compliance issues that ensures competence. • Provides timely daily compliance question and answer support for local Alliant employee benefits practice based on regional or office assignments in a timely manner; ensures issues are triaged and addressed per established national Compliance engagement protocol. • Contributes in developing processes and a templates library to support client service teams, updating them as needed. • Participates in prospect meetings per established National Compliance engagement protocol to present Alliant Compliance capabilities. • Performs all duties in accordance with all company policies and procedures, and all federal, state and local laws, wherein the Company operates. • Performs other duties as assigned.

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or's Degree or equivalent combination of education and work experience. • Eight (8) or more years of related work experience in the employee benefits and compliance areas • Experience drafting white papers on benefits compliance issues and written legal analysis • Experience in public speaking, including developing and delivering benefits compliance training content • ATT-JD - Attorney • Active State Bar License
